Abstract

The Enaex Mining Technical Solutions (EMTS) team, in partnership with the Anglo American Iron Ore Brazil drilling and blasting team, has developed a study aiming to optimize the blast design applied at the Minas-Rio project. The study consists of modeling the dynamic behavior of one lithological domain to determine the best configuration of drilling pattern, charge configuration, timing and sequencing of the blast designs applied at the mine in this particular rock.
